In 1891, Fannie Mae Billings entered the world in Tennessee, born to William Franklin Billings and Ada (Adar) REDMan. Fannie Mae Billings married Robert Taylor "Bob" Manning, and had children including Genevia E. Manning, Alvin Lee Manning, Frank Edward Manning, Toy Raymond Manning, John Cordell Manning, Cardell Manning, Oscar C Manning, Charie Ray Manning. Fannie Mae Billings passed away in 1963 in DeKalb County, Tennessee, United States of America.
